B. REITAN & SØNN AS is registered as a limited company in Kristiansund, Møre og Romsdal with organisation number 998353637. The business is classified under construction of residential and non-residential buildings (NACE 41.000). The company was incorporated in 2012. Registered share capital is NOK 30,000, divided into 30 shares. The company's stated purpose is: “Drive innen bygg og anlegg samt hva som naturlig faller sammen med dette.”. The most recent filed accounts, for the 2025 financial year, show NOK 2.0m in revenue and NOK 4,000 in operating profit.
